- Additional information
- This paper describes the only-to-date 3D fractional viscoelastic model which enables the description of the viscoelastic behaviour of a complex material system with only two material parameters. The work, which set the basis for two subsequent papers (authored by the second author), has attracted the attention of the orthopaedic implants industry in order to model the wear of Ultra High Molecular Weight Polyethylene components. The work has formed the basis for attracting funding to set up the knee wear lab at Oxford Brookes University.
